Citadel resolves spat with JP Morgan

Monday, September 22, 2008 : Permalink

JP Morgan Chase & Co and Citadel Investment Group resumed trading with each other on Friday, one day after the bank had cut off the hedge fund over a hiring dispute, a person familiar with the matter said.

"The dispute has been resolved," a person familiar with the hedge fund said on Friday.

Citadel’s officials could not be reached for comment at the office.

Citadel, one of the world’s largest hedge fund firms with roughly $20 billion in assets, clashed with JP Morgan because it had hired a string of executives from America’s second largest bank this year, people familiar with the matter said.

They said JP Morgan told employees to stop trading stocks, bonds and currencies with Citadel on Thursday morning, essentially prohibiting anyone from buying or selling with the hedge fund.

By Friday, the differences had been resolved and business was back to normal, the person said.
